Jalur &Sumber Daya Pembelajaran Python yang Komprehensif
Di halaman ini, Anda dapat menjelajahi semua konten pembelajaran dikelompokkan berdasarkan topik atau tingkat keahlian . Gunakan halaman ini untuk mendapatkan ide tentang hal yang perlu dipelajari selanjutnya.
- Mencari panduan? Ikuti jalur pembelajaran terstruktur untuk pemula, developer menengah, dan praktisi tingkat lanjut.
- Butuh sesuatu yang spesifik? Gunakan halaman pencarian untuk memfilter berdasarkan jenis sumber daya (artikel, kursus, kuis, dan lainnya), tingkat keahlian, atau status penyelesaian.
Jika Anda baru memulai dengan Python, mulailah dengan Jalur Pembelajaran Dasar-Dasar Python kami untuk membangun dasar yang kuat dalam sintaksis, struktur data, fungsi, dan pemrograman berorientasi objek:
Untuk konten terstruktur tentang topik populer seperti otomatisasi , pembelajaran mesin , ilmu data , pengembangan web , dan banyak lagi, lihat Jalur Pembelajaran di luar inti Python.
Jelajahi berdasarkan topik atau tingkat keahlian di bawah. Selamat belajar!
Tingkat Pengalaman
Tingkat • dasar-dasar
Dasar-dasar Python
Pelajari Python dari awal dengan tutorial ramah pemula yang mencakup variabel, loop, fungsi, struktur data, dan banyak lagi. Tidak diperlukan pengalaman.
Tingkat • tingkat lanjut
Tutorial Python Tingkat Lanjut
Jelajahi topik Python tingkat lanjut seperti konkurensi, metaprogramming, pengoptimalan kinerja, dan internal CPython. Untuk pengembang berpengalaman.
Topik
Topik • ai
Pengkodean Python Dengan AI
Pelajari cara menulis kode Python dengan bantuan AI, dan belajar membuat program Python praktis di dunia nyata yang memanfaatkan LLM.
Topik • algoritma
Tutorial Algoritma
Pelajari algoritma Python:pengurutan, pencarian, grafik, DP, Big O. Gunakan heapq, membagi dua, deque, lru_cache, timeit. Pelajari tips praktis dan FAQ untuk wawancara.
Topik • api
Tutorial API Python
Pelajari cara merancang, membangun, mengamankan, dan menggunakan API Python dengan FastAPI, Flask, Django, Requests, OpenAPI, pengujian, Docker, dan tip penerapan.
Topik • praktik terbaik
Praktik Terbaik Python
Belajar menyusun fungsi, memberi nama dengan jelas, menangani kesalahan, dan mengatur proyek. Kirimkan perangkat lunak yang dapat dipelihara dengan percaya diri.
Topik • karir
Karier Python
Latih tantangan, tinjau struktur data, dan jelaskan solusi dengan jelas. Bangun portofolio dan rencanakan peran Anda selanjutnya.
Topik • komunitas
Artikel Komunitas Python
Kenali sesama pembuat kode melalui artikel dan wawancara. Terhubung dengan komunitas Python yang lebih luas untuk berkolaborasi dan belajar.
Topik • database
Tutorial Basis Data Python
Berinteraksi dengan database SQL, NoSQL, dan vektor menggunakan Python. Bangun aplikasi intensif data untuk pengembangan web, analisis data, dan aplikasi AI.
Topik • ilmu data
Ilmu Data Python
Jelajahi semua tutorial ilmu data Python. Pelajari cara menganalisis dan memvisualisasikan data menggunakan Python. Dengan keterampilan ini, Anda dapat memperoleh wawasan dari kumpulan data yang besar dan membuat keputusan berdasarkan data.
Topik • struktur data
Struktur Data
Pelajari kapan menggunakan daftar, tupel, dikt, dan set. Lihat kompleksitas waktu, pilih alat yang tepat, dan tulis kode yang lebih cepat dan bersih.
Topik • data-yaitu
Visualisasi Data Python
Jelajahi berbagai perpustakaan dan gunakan untuk mengkomunikasikan data Anda secara visual dengan Python. Sajikan data kompleks dalam format yang mudah dipahami.
Topik • pengembang
Tutorial DevOps Python
Kirim aplikasi Python dengan percaya diri. Pelajari praktik Docker, Ansible, CI/CD, Kubernetes, Nginx, dan pemantauan untuk mengotomatiskan penerapan dan menjalankan sistem produksi yang andal.
Topik • django
Tutorial Django
Pelajari Django melalui proyek praktis dunia nyata. Django adalah kerangka web Python tingkat tinggi untuk mengembangkan aplikasi web kompleks dengan cepat.
Topik • buruh pelabuhan
Tutorial Docker Python
Pelajari Docker, alat containerisasi untuk membuat lingkungan aplikasi yang terisolasi dan dapat direproduksi. Dengan Docker, Anda dapat mengelola dan menerapkan aplikasi Python Anda dengan lebih efisien.
Topik • editor
Editor &IDE
Pelajari tentang alat baru atau pelajari lebih dalam editor favorit Anda. Pengetahuan ini akan menyederhanakan proses pengembangan Python Anda.
Topik • labu
Tutorial Labu
Pelajari aspek-aspek penting dalam pengembangan Flask. Dengan pengetahuan ini, Anda akan mampu membuat aplikasi web yang kuat dan skalabel menggunakan Flask.
Topik • gui
Pemrograman GUI Python
Buat antarmuka pengguna grafis menggunakan berbagai kerangka kerja Python. Mulailah pemrograman GUI dengan Python untuk membangun aplikasi yang mudah digunakan.
Topik • pembelajaran mesin
Pembelajaran Mesin Python
Pelajari cara mengimplementasikan algoritma pembelajaran mesin (ML) dengan Python. Dengan keterampilan ini, Anda dapat menciptakan sistem cerdas yang mampu mempelajari dan mengambil keputusan.
Topik • berita
Berita Python
Ikuti perkembangan terkini untuk inti Python dan ekosistem pihak ketiga yang lebih luas. Berita penting Python untuk Anda, dikurasi oleh tim Real Python.
Topik • numpy
NumPy
Buat dan potong array, bandingkan dengan daftar, dan jalankan operasi cepat. Pahami kapan NumPy cocok dan latih pola inti langkah demi langkah.
Topik • proyek
Proyek Python
Kerjakan proyek Python yang membantu Anda mendapatkan pengalaman pemrograman dunia nyata. Proyek ini mencakup kode sumber lengkap dan petunjuk langkah demi langkah.
Topik • ular piton
Tutorial Inti Python
Selami inti bahasa Python. Pahami fitur inti Python untuk mendapatkan dasar yang kuat untuk pemrograman Python tingkat lanjut.
Topik • stdlib
Perpustakaan Standar Python
Tutorial praktis pustaka standar Python untuk menguasai datetime, pathlib, argparse, subproses, logging, dan banyak lagi. Tulis kode yang lebih cepat, lebih bersih, dan bebas ketergantungan.
Topik • pengujian
Tutorial Pengujian Python
Temukan praktik dan teknik terbaik untuk menguji aplikasi Python Anda guna membangun aplikasi yang kuat dan bebas bug.
Topik • alat
Alat Pengembangan Python
Pilih editor Anda, kelola venvs, gunakan Git, jalankan pytest, perbaiki kode otomatis dengan Ruff. Tambahkan mypy, CI, packing, dan Docker untuk dikirimkan dengan percaya diri.
Topik • pengembangan web
Tutorial Pengembangan Web Python
Pelajari solusi dunia nyata untuk masalah dalam pengembangan aplikasi Web Python. Tutorial dan artikel ini mencakup teknik-teknik utama yang digunakan di lapangan. Berbekal pengetahuan tersebut, Anda dapat membuat aplikasi web modern.
Topik • pengikisan web
Tutorial Pengikisan Web Python
Pelajari web scraping dengan proyek praktis dunia nyata. Unduh dan pilih data dari web dengan Python. Otomatiskan proses ekstraksi data dari situs web.